    ABOUT THE ROLE:

    We are looking for an experienced Practice Manager to join our senior leadership team at Park Vet Group and manage our 4 sites Glenfield, Whetstone, Scraptoft Lane and Saffron Lane. This is an exciting opportunity for someone with strong management skills who is passionate about supporting veterinary teams to deliver excellent animal care.
    This role will be based across all sites and due to the requirements for movement between sites, a vehicle will be required.
    As Practice Manager, you will play a key role in the daily operations of our veterinary practice. You will work closely with the clinical team to ensure a smooth workflow and that our patients receive the highest level of care. You will manage the practice’s financials, including billing, insurance claims, debt, and budget tracking, as well as oversee staffing, equipment, and facility maintenance. Above all, you will be responsible for maintaining a positive, client-focused environment that supports both our staff and patients.

    K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:

    • Financial Management: Ensure the effective management of practice income and expenditure, oversee the debt management processes, manage billing and banking, and collaborate with the Clinical Director to meet the practice’s financial targets. Payroll processing is the responsibility of the Practice Manager.
    • Operational Management: Oversee the smooth operation of the practice daily, ensuring that all clinical and administrative workflows are efficient and that any issues are addressed promptly to avoid disruption to patient care.
    • Staffing and HR: Lead the recruitment, training, and development of practice non-clinical staff and support with recruitment within all teams, ensuring a motivated and skilled team. Foster a supportive work environment and maintain high levels of employee satisfaction and retention.
    • Health and Safety: Work with the practice’s Health and Safety Partner to ensure the practice adheres to all veterinary health and safety protocols, maintaining up-to-date documentation and providing a safe working environment for both staff and patients.
    • Facility and Equipment Management: Ensure that the practice facilities are well-maintained and fully equipped to provide high-quality veterinary care. Oversee equipment procurement, inventory management, and regular maintenance checks.
    • Client Experience: Collaborate with the Client Care Manager to maintain a welcoming, professional, and compassionate atmosphere for clients and their pets, ensuring that all client interactions are positive and that any complaints or concerns are dealt with promptly and professionally.
